cruise control stops working on rough road

2003 f150 super crew pickup. Cruise control will stop working when on rough road. sometimes can hit the resume button and will start working again. sometime must reset the cruise control to get it working again.

Because you have to reset the Cruise Control sometimes, I would suspect an intermittent electrical connection in your brake lighting. This could be either in your two standard brake lights or in the third, center mounted brake lights. A failure in any of these circuits would render the CC inoperative. You might have a faulty ground connection on any of them, or, it could also be a connection in the positive feed. A rough road would "shake" the connections and possibly "break" the circuit.

The other possibility is the brake switch itself. Again, a rough road might activate the brake switch momentarily which would cancel the CC. But, if this were the cause, I would expect it to reset with "Resume" all the time.
